10 featuresOrnith-1.0 sits in PulseGate's Foundation models & chat category. Enabling developers to use and improve open-source coding models that can self-scaffold and generate code autonomously. Ornith-1.0 is an open-source project aimed at AI researchers and developers. Ornith-1.0 is open source under the Open Source license. It runs on the web, the command line, and API, and it can be self-hosted.
It is developed by DeepReinforce, and it first shipped in 2026. Among its 10 catalogued features are self-improving model, open-source weights, and agentic scaffolding. The interface is available in 5 languages, including Arabic, German, and English.
